Output 34cd5df75d81c45d1a3da7faab6bd6a04642f718d7e52c466f5ed9ef7f8a95c2:49

value
137429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185ea61a4d9fac3ddb156a02cd8feac41ba5698a OP_EQUAL
address
33usXTt9ntdgfFeBHqB22HtM3QqF97Rn5t
transaction
34cd5df75d81c45d1a3da7faab6bd6a04642f718d7e52c466f5ed9ef7f8a95c2